Output 2688a401231d3b03d5f91422860fecc78b5e8d3f9c7e5e116589924e3894385d:0

value
59370314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d27089ea00b3c1ccf85bc0cdd1be22d62476602 OP_EQUAL
address
3MrN23aTNEPwEYTgSGT6stTU8iGh2mSW1f
transaction
2688a401231d3b03d5f91422860fecc78b5e8d3f9c7e5e116589924e3894385d